summaryrefslogtreecommitdiff
path: root/lang/caml-light/files/patch-ab
diff options
context:
space:
mode:
Diffstat (limited to 'lang/caml-light/files/patch-ab')
-rw-r--r--lang/caml-light/files/patch-ab71
1 files changed, 71 insertions, 0 deletions
diff --git a/lang/caml-light/files/patch-ab b/lang/caml-light/files/patch-ab
new file mode 100644
index 000000000000..f9fb792626a3
--- /dev/null
+++ b/lang/caml-light/files/patch-ab
@@ -0,0 +1,71 @@
+--- contrib/Makefile-- Mon Dec 1 23:47:01 1997
++++ contrib/Makefile Mon Jul 27 12:27:01 1998
+@@ -5,7 +5,7 @@
+ # Remember that "libunix" is required for
+ # "debugger", "libgraph", "camltk", "camltk4", and "search_isos".
+ PACKAGES=libunix libgraph debugger libnum libstr mletags \
+- camlmode lorder profiler camltk4 camlsearch
++ camlmode lorder profiler camlsearch
+ # caml-tex
+ # caml-latex2e
+ # camltk
+@@ -22,7 +22,7 @@
+ # and /usr/ccs/lib/cpp under Solaris.
+ # The -P option suppresses the generation of "# linenum" directives,
+ # which are not understood by Caml Light.
+-CPP=/lib/cpp -P
++CPP=/usr/bin/cpp -P
+
+ # Test to see whether ranlib exists on the machine
+ RANLIBTEST=test -f /usr/bin/ranlib -o -f /bin/ranlib
+@@ -31,26 +31,26 @@
+ RANLIB=ranlib
+
+ # The directory where public executables will be installed
+-BINDIR=/usr/local/bin
++BINDIR=${PREFIX}/bin
+
+ # The directory where library files will be installed
+-LIBDIR=/usr/local/lib/caml-light
++LIBDIR=${PREFIX}/lib/caml-light
+
+ # The manual section where the manual pages will be installed
+ MANEXT=1
+
+ # The directory where the manual pages will be installed
+-MANDIR=/usr/local/man/man$(MANEXT)
++MANDIR=${PREFIX}/man/man$(MANEXT)
+
+ # The path to the include directory containing the X11/*.h includes
+ # (usually /usr/include; for SunOS with OpenLook, /usr/openwin/include)
+ # Needed for the "libgraph" and "camltk" packages.
+-X11_INCLUDES=/usr/X11R6/include
++X11_INCLUDES=${X11BASE}/include
+
+ # The path to the directory containing the X11 libraries.
+ # (usually /usr/lib; for SunOS with OpenLook, /usr/openwin/lib)
+ # Needed for the "libgraph" and "camltk" packages.
+-X11_LIB=/usr/X11R6/lib
++X11_LIB=${X11BASE}/lib
+
+ # Name of the target architecture.
+ # Used only for the libnum library (arbitrary-precision arithmetic), to
+@@ -62,15 +62,15 @@
+ # See the file libnum/README for more explanations.
+ # If you don't know, leave BIGNUM_ARCH=C, which selects a portable
+ # C implementation of these routines.
+-BIGNUM_ARCH=C
++BIGNUM_ARCH=pentium
+
+ # Name of the directory where LaTeX style files should be installed.
+ # Needed only for the "caml-tex" and "caml-latex2e" packages.
+-TEXINPUTDIR=/usr/lib/texmf/tex/latex/etc
++TEXINPUTDIR=${PREFIX}/lib/texmf/tex/latex/etc
+
+ # Name of the directory where Emacs Lisp files should be installed.
+ # Needed only for the "camlmode" package.
+-EMACSLISPDIR=/usr/lib/emacs/site-lisp
++EMACSLISPDIR=${PREFIX}/share/emacs/site-lisp
+
+ # Name of the directories where the tcl.h and tk.h includes can be found.
+ # Needed only for the "camltk" package.